Net 2 Comunicaciones S.A. is a Guatemala company, located in 13 C 1-51 Z-10 Edif SClar; Guatemala; Guatemala. more detail is as below.
- Log in to post comments
Net 2 Comunicaciones S.A. is a Guatemala company, located in 13 C 1-51 Z-10 Edif SClar; Guatemala; Guatemala. more detail is as below.